Legal Considerations for Selling Bitcoin
Depending on your jurisdiction, selling Bitcoin may be subject to specific laws and regulations. Here are some key legal considerations to keep in mind:
Taxation: Bitcoin is treated as property in most countries, so you may be liable for capital gains tax or income tax on profits generated from selling it.
Anti-Money Laundering (AML) and Know Your Customer (KYC): Crypto exchanges often require you to undergo AML and KYC checks to prevent money laundering and other illegal activities. This may involve providing personal information and documentation.
Financial Crime: Selling Bitcoin to individuals or entities involved in criminal activities, such as money laundering or terrorism financing, may be illegal and could lead to legal consequences.
Step-by-Step Guide to Selling Bitcoin Legally
Once you have considered the legal implications, follow these steps to sell Bitcoin legally:
1. Choose a Reputable Crypto Exchange
Select a crypto exchange that is regulated, has a proven track record, and complies with AML and KYC regulations. This will help ensure the legitimacy and security of your transactions.
2. Verify Your Identity
Complete the exchange's required AML and KYC checks by providing personal information, such as your name, address, and government-issued ID. This helps prevent fraud and money laundering.
3. Deposit Your Bitcoin
Transfer your Bitcoin from your personal wallet to the exchange's wallet. The exchange will provide you with instructions on how to do this.
4. Create a Sell Order
Create a sell order on the exchange, specifying the amount of Bitcoin you want to sell and the desired price or market order. A market order will sell your Bitcoin immediately at the prevailing market price.
5. Monitor the Transaction
Once you place your sell order, monitor it to ensure it is executed as expected. The exchange will typically provide you with updates on the status of your order.
6. Withdraw Your Funds
After your Bitcoin is sold, you can withdraw the proceeds to your bank account or another cryptocurrency wallet. The exchange may charge a small fee for this.
7. Keep Records
Maintain detailed records of your Bitcoin transactions, including the date, time, amount, and the exchange used. This will be helpful for tax purposes or if you need to prove your compliance.
Additional Tips for Selling Bitcoin Safely
In addition to following the legal requirements and steps above, consider these additional tips to ensure your Bitcoin sale is safe:* Use a strong and unique password for your crypto exchange account.
*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) to protect your account from unauthorized access.
* Store your Bitcoin in a secure hardware wallet to prevent online theft.
* Be wary of phishing scams that attempt to trick you into giving up your personal information or account details.
* Sell your Bitcoin in smaller batches to minimize the impact of market fluctuations.
* Research reputable buyers before selling your Bitcoin over-the-counter (OTC).
